config flowstats filter ports
config flowstats filter <filter#> {aggregation} {export <group#>} ports
<portlist> [ingress | egress] <filterspec>
Description
Configures a flow record filter for the specified ports.
Syntax Description
Default
N/A.
Usage Guidelines
Configuring a filter specification enables that filter for the specified ports. To specify all ports, you can
use specify them as the range of all ports (such as 1-32 or 7:1-7:4) or in the form <slot>:* on a modular
switch.
filter#
The
filter#
parameter is an integer in the range from 1 to 8 that identifies the filter being
defined.
<group#>
Specifies the group number that identifies the set of flow collector devices to which records
for flows matching the filter are to be exported. If Group is not specified , then group # 1 will
be used as default export group.
aggregation
To reduce the volume of exported data, use this optional keyword to maintain a single set
of statistics for all the flows that match the specified filter.
filterspec
Specifies a set of five parameters (four are value/mask pairs) that define the criteria by
which a flow is evaluated to determine if it should be exported. The parameters are:
[{dest-ip <ipaddress_value/mask ipaddress_filtermask>} {source-ip
<ipaddress_value/mask ipaddress_filtermask> } {dest-port
<port_value/port_filtermask> } {source-port
<port_value/port_filtermask> } {protocol
<tcp/udp/ip/protocol_value/protocol_filtermask>} | match-all-flows
|match-no-flows ]
All five specifications must be included in the order specified.
The range for port/port_mask is calculated using the following formula:
(minport = port, maxport = 2^(32-port_mask)-1).
Conceptually, the filters work by ANDing the contents of each of the five components of a
forwarded flow with the associated masks from the first defined filter (filter #1). Statistics are
maintained if the results of the AND operations match the configured filter values for all
fields of the sequence. If there is no match, then the operation is repeated for filter #2, and
so on. If there is no match for any of the filters, then statistics are not maintained for the
flow. Filters for any or all of the sequence components can be configured with a single
command.
match-all-flows
Specifies that the filter should match any flow.
match-no-flows
Specifies that the filter should discard all flow. This option is not valid for Ethernet blades.
egress
Specifies that the filter should capture only egress traffic. This option is not valid for
Ethernet blades.
ingress
Specifies that the filter should capture only ingress traffic.
